Talat: "Greek leader made ugly attack"
Turkish Cyprus Presedent Talat slammed Greek leader's comments in an Austrian newspaper.
Thursday, 03 July 2008 18:15

President of the Turkish Republic of Northern Cyprus (TRNC) Mehmet Ali Talat said Thursday that "the TRNC is not giving up sovereignty but rather sharing it in a new partnership with the Greek Cypriots."

Talat said that the leader of Greek Cypriot administration Demetris Christofias made an ugly attack by saying that "Talat may fight against Turkey."

"The sovereignty and citizenship in Cyprus would be single and we will discuss how to implement a solution in our comprehensive negotiations," Talat said.

Reminded about comments made by Christofias to an Austrian newspaper that "Talat and I are making efforts against the occupation and dependence on motherlands", Talat said that Christofias was lying.

"Christofias made an ugly attack by his statements. His comments came so as to leave me in a difficult position," Talat also said.
